As nouns, iguanid lizard is a hypernym of chuckwalla; that is, iguanid lizard is a word with a broader meaning than chuckwalla:
  • chuckwalla: a herbivorous lizard that lives among rocks in the arid parts of southwestern United States and Mexico
  • iguanid lizard: lizards of the New World and Madagascar and some Pacific islands; typically having a long tail and bright throat patch in males
Other hypernyms of chuckwalla include iguanid.
